Janet Blazek Valdes

Ms. Valdes has a distinguished career as a trusted executive, operations officer, and human resources director. She brings over twenty years of experience in the financial services and legal industries, where she excelled in mid to large sized firms and built/grew emerging growth companies from good to great. With this depth of knowledge and experience, Janet joined Astronaut, LLC in Houston, Texas as President. Recently, Valdes was the Assistant Firm Administrator and Head of Human Resources of a premier, mid-sized litigation firm, Quilling, Selander, Lownds, Winslet and Moser in Dallas, Texas. Valdes was the Director of Operations and Director of Human Resources for Carter Advisory Services and Carter Financial Management: An Independent Registered Investment Advisor with $1.3 billion AUM. Valdes was the Managing Director and Director of Human Resources for Integrated Financial Solutions Group where she and the CEO built the company from the ground up. As former Principal of Stonebridge Partners, Janet marketed funds for venture capital and global private equity firms. Janet was the Chief Operating Officer at Corbin & Company Capital Management. Valdes began her career at Goldman Sachs in New York City as a financial analyst. She has a bachelor’s degree from Harvard University. As a Board Member of The Catholic League for the Poor of Nigeria, Janet focuses on raising funds to build a hospital and mental health facility in Odepke Anambra State Nigeria. A Leadership Dallas/Fort Worth alumni, Janet is also a member of the Harvard Business School Club of Dallas and the Harvard Clubs of Nigeria, Dallas and Houston. She is the former founder of IvyPlus, an Ivy League networking group.
